Toyota RAV4: Headlight switch
The headlights can be operated manually or automatically.
Type A
1 Vehicles with daytime running light system: The daytime running lights turn on.
2 The side marker, parking, tail, license plate, daytime running lights and instrument panel lights turn on.
3 The headlights and all lights listed above (except daytime running lights) turn on.
4 (if equipped) The headlights, parking lights and daytime running lights turn on and off automatically. (When the “ENGINE START STOP” switch or the engine switch is in ON)
